Geography Profile:

Shamirpet features a moderately elevated terrain with significant natural water bodies.

Shamirpet is situated on a moderately elevated terrain, with an average elevation of approximately 574 meters (1,883 feet) above sea level. The landscape is characterized by undulating land and rock formations, typical of the Deccan Plateau. The area is notably defined by the presence of Shamirpet Lake, a significant artificial water body that contributes to the local ecosystem and offers scenic beauty.

ParameterValue
Elevation574 m above sea level
Terrain TypeUndulating plateau
Water BodiesShamirpet Lake

Soil & Ecology:

The region features diverse soil types supporting a mix of flora and local biodiversity.

The soil in Shamirpet is predominantly red sandy loam, characteristic of the Telangana region, which supports a variety of local flora. The ecology around Shamirpet Lake and Deer Park is rich, with deciduous forest areas providing habitat for various species of deer, peacocks, and numerous migratory and resident birds.

Climate Snapshot:

Experience a tropical savanna climate with distinct dry and wet seasons.

Shamirpet experiences a tropical savanna climate, characterized by hot summers, a moderate monsoon season, and pleasant winters. Temperatures generally range from 20°C to 40°C throughout the year, with May being the hottest month. The region receives moderate annual rainfall, primarily during the monsoon months from June to September. The dry season extends from November to May, offering cooler and drier weather, ideal for outdoor activities.

ParameterValue
Air QualityGood
Annual Rainfall mm834
Best Outdoor SeasonNov-Mar
Monsoon MonthsJun-Sep
Temperature Range20°C to 40°C

Legal Ownership (India):

Open to Indian residents and NRIs for residential and commercial property

Indian citizens and resident buyers enjoy unrestricted ownership of residential and commercial real estate. NRI/OCI buyers follow FEMA regulations — residential/commercial allowed, agricultural land only via inheritance. Foreign nationals cannot purchase property in India except by inheritance.

Always consult a licensed real estate attorney before purchase. Rules change; verify current law.

Buyer TypePermittedTenureConditionsApproval
Indian ResidentYesFreeholdUnrestricted purchase of residential, commercial, agriculturalNone
NRI / OCIConditionalFreeholdResidential and commercial allowed; agri/plantation/farmhouse only via inheritanceFEMA / RBI compliance
Foreign NationalNoNoneCannot purchase; inheritance allowed from Indian residentNot applicable

Capital Gains Tax (India):

Understanding capital gains tax on property sales in India.

Capital gains tax is levied on the profit from selling property. It is categorized into short-term and long-term, depending on the holding period, with different tax implications.

Always confirm with a qualified tax professional.

Holding PeriodClassificationTax RateIndexation
Less than 24 monthsShort-Term Capital Gain (STCG)As per income tax slabNot applicable
More than 24 months (property acquired before July 23, 2024)Long-Term Capital Gain (LTCG)20% with indexation or 12.5% without indexation (taxpayer's option)Applicable (optional at 20% rate)
More than 24 months (property acquired on or after July 23, 2024)Long-Term Capital Gain (LTCG)12.5% without indexationNot applicable
